English: "Map of the Ground and Design for the Improvement of The Soldiers' National Cemetery, Gettysburg, PA. 1863, by William Saunders, Landscape Gardener, Germantown, Pena."
Date
Source John Russell Bartlett, The Soldiers' National Cemetery at Gettysburg (Providence, RI: Board of Comissioners of the Soldiers' National Cemetery, 1874), opposite page 12.[1]
Author William Saunders (1822-1900)
